Sunnybank House is a state-of-the-art care home situated in the heart of Fair Oak in Eastleigh. A modern, purpose-built care home, it is well placed for trips out to the surrounding picturesque villages of Bishops Waltham, Botley and beyond.

Combining luxurious surrounding with genuinely caring people, Sunnybank House offers a high-quality care home environment. This is a place where quality and compassion are stitched into the fabric of the building, creating a warm and supportive atmosphere in which residents can live a comfortable and fulfilled life.

They know their skilled care at Sunnybank House is a source of reassurance to residents and their families, and are able to provide residential care and residential care to residents living with dementia.

Sunnybank has a hairdressing salon, chiropody and in-house laundry service. They also have a lovely garden room, visitors' lounge, landscaped gardens with patios and communal spaces where the team delivers a range of activities that both stimulates and engages all residents.

My Mother moved into Sunnybank House, on to the dementia floor, in September 2014 just after it opened. The staff were friendly and caring and Mum settled in immediately and was very happy. In the two and a half years since then, there have been five different managers plus a high turnover of carers
and a change of ownership. Despite all that Mum received very good care and remained happy and contented. Sunnybank is always well maintained and clean and the food is very good and plentiful. Management and carers were always happy to discuss the care of my Mother with us if we had any concerns.
Residents have a variety of activities and entertainments to keep them stimulated and active. There is hope that the long awaited mini bus will arrive soon to enable residents to go on occasional outings.

My mother moved to Suunybank House in November 2014. From feeling isolated in her flat, as she became more infirm, she immediately had the reassurance of kind and supportive staff, and the company of others. The rooms are spacious with large en-suites, attractively decorated and kept clean and fresh.
The communal rooms are brightly decorated and activities are organised on all three floors for a change of scene. Family and visitors are always welcomed.


The daily activities include crafts such as making cards, painting, cooking and physical activities, such as simple ball games etc. which can cause much merriment. Of course, these activities are purely voluntary. Regular visits by a variety of entertainers are arranged and there are attractive grounds for occasional garden parties.
I would highly recommend this care home to others.

Detailed Breakdown of Review Score

The maximum Review Score for a Care Home is 10, which is made up from the Average Rating of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) and the Number of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) in the last 24 months:

  • a) 5 Points are available for the Average Rating from all Reviews in the last 24 months.

    The Average Rating of 4.865 for Sunnybank House Care Home is calculated as follows: ( (476 Excellents x 5) + (68 Goods x 4) + (3 Satisfactorys x 3) ) ÷ 547 Ratings = 4.865

  • b) 5 Points are available for the number of Positive Reviews in the last 24 months. A Positive Review is defined as any Review with an 'Overall Experience' of '4' or '5' (out of a max rating '5').

    The 5 Points relating to the number of positive Reviews for Sunnybank House Care Home is based on 47 positive Reviews in the last 24 months and is calculated as per below:

    The 5 points available are broken down as follows:

    • i) 4 points are available for the first 10 Positive Reviews in the last 24 months; 3 points for the first Positive Review, and then 0.125 Points for each of the next four Positive Reviews and then 0.1 Points for the next five Positive Reviews. (1st = 3.000, 2nd = 0.125, 3rd = 0.125, 4th = 0.125, 5th = 0.125, 6th = 0.100, 7th = 0.100, 8th = 0.100, 9th = 0.100, 10th = 0.100) 3 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 = 4

    • ii) 1 point is available for the number of Positive Reviews reaching 20% of the registered maximum number of service users in the last 24 months. If this number is partially reached, then that proportion of 1 point is given. eg a Care Home registered for a maximum of 50 service users has to reach 10 Positive Reviews to receive 1 point, if it has 7 reviews it will receive 0.7 points. 20% of the 60 registered maximum number of service users is 12, which has been reached with 47 Positive reviews. Points = 1

  • When a Review is submitted by someone who has previously submitted a Review, only the latest Review will count towards the Review Score.

  • If a Care Home does not have a review in the last 24 months, then it will not have a Review Score.
